Earn your Master of Science in Corporate and Organizational Communication at Northeastern

Offered through Northeastern University’s College of Professional Studies, the Master of Science in Corporate and Organizational Communication provides you with the skills necessary to develop, manage, and deliver global communications.

–    Core Curriculum: From meeting management and intercultural communication to crisis management and assessment, this master’s degree examines topics that are critical to effective organizational communication

 

–    Concentration Variety*: Six degree concentrations are available in areas such as human resources management, sport and social change, leadership, project management, and social media and online communities

 

–    Flexible Formats: Two degree formats are offered, an intensive 12-month online fast-track format where courses are delivered 100% online and an “at your own pace” format, where courses are delivered online or on campus, for maximum flexibility and work, life, learning balance

 

–    Expert Faculty: Instructors represent industry professionals, scholars, and mentors, offering valuable real-world experience within program curriculum and everyday classroom learning
